There are 2 modules in this course

This Scrum course provides a comprehensive journey into agile practices, equipping you with the skills to master Scrum and Kanban methodologies. Start with the history of Scrum, its evolution, and essential artifacts. Understand comprehensive frameworks and gain practical insights into Scrum boards, crafting good user stories, splitting stories, and effective release planning. Learn to manage time efficiently, navigate the Scrum lifecycle, and understand roles through real-world demos. Explore the differences between Scrum and Kanban to determine the best approach for diverse project needs. Ideal for anyone seeking to excel in agile environments and drive project success.

Explore Scrum roles, lifecycle execution, and Kanban principles while comparing Agile frameworks.
